More than half a year in Korea and I can't believe I only visited the Garden of the Morning Calm recently. No regrets. Spring season is definitely the best time to see this place.
Located in Gapyeong, the ride from Seoul takes around 2-3 hours, depending on which train you ride and the traffic. We rode the subway from Seoul Station to Cheongpyeong Station. From there, you can take the Gapyeong shuttle bus to go to the garden. (The bus schedule is at the end of this post.)

Other than taking breathtaking photos of the view, you can enjoy the place by having a picnic. A lot of families, couples and kids come to the garden to bond and unwind. The kids loved running around the vast open spaces while their parents lay on the grass and enjoyed the fresh air.
You can also make your own wish towers by simply stacking up 7 (or any odd number) rocks by the stream. Just make sure you don't topple other towers down or you might just have ruined someone else's wishes. :))
PRICE: 8,000 KRW or 8 USD entrance fee
FOOD:
There are at least two restaurants (a vegetarian and a Chinese one) but the food is limited and quite pricey. I suggest bringing some snacks. There's a snack bar just right outside the main entrance.

HOW TO GET THERE:
Take subway and get off at Cheongpyeong Station.
From Cheongpyeong station, take Gapyeong shuttle bus to the Garden of the Morning Calm (It takes 20 min. You can buy the ticket from the driver. The ticker costs 5,000 KRW but you can use this ticket again to go back or visit nearby attractions like Petite France and Nami Island)
